Output 95fc5989568918ef8b55902f11ae24c5f6670869a81163b69280ab2fcbf2639e:94

value
93491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df430a2ebdad3655651708f91b1b81c5f7f4a9df OP_EQUALVERIFY OP_CHECKSIG
address
1MMVznSZVTPx4ugowFMh7swNvA9fdKzkqG
transaction
95fc5989568918ef8b55902f11ae24c5f6670869a81163b69280ab2fcbf2639e
spent
true